Indicators for mapping and assessment of ecosystem condition and of the ecosystem service habitat maintenance in support of the EU Biodiversity Strategy to 2020

Abstract: A systematic approach to map and assess the “maintenance of nursery populations and habitats” ecosystem service (ES) (hereinafter called “habitat maintenance”) has not yet emerged. In this article, we present an ecosystem service framework implementation at landscape level, by proposing an approach for calculating and combining a series of indicators with spatial modelling techniques. “…Fish lifecycle support capacity was estimated by extrapolating the distribution of mugilids fingerlings in the most confined part of the lagoon, retrieved from a spatialized food-web model of the Venice lagoon based on functional groups (Anelli Monti et al, 2021). For migratory birds, we mapped for each one of the valli da pesca the favorable factors, namely saltmarshes, freshwater presence, shrubs, and herbaceous vegetation, that enhance the attractiveness for resting and molt changing Havera et al, 1992;Hatziiordanou et al, 2019). Fish and waterbird lifecycle support capacities were normalized on a 0-1 scale.…”

“…During the past five years, various studies guided by the MAES conceptual framework [2] have been conducted in Greece, providing information for different types of ecosystems and applying different methodologies and tools for mapping and assessing ES at local (e.g., Reference [39]), regional [40] and national levels [41][42][43][44]. In 2017, a group of scientists who believed in the importance of the MAES implementation (forming the Hellenic Ecosystem Partnership-HESP [45]) drafted the National Agenda for the MAES implementation in Greece [34] and set an Action Plan to 2020, including shortand mid-term objectives.…”
